Some might say “it’s a good problem to have,” but in my writing, I tend to use the word verses more often than its homonym, versus. Especially since January when I joined the read-through-the-Bible-in-two-years opportunity, STOP2Read, coordinated by our friends Edie Melson and Cynthia Cavanaugh. We often chat amongst ourselves in the commentary section about favorite verses from the day’s passage, challenging ones, puzzling verses, and especially inspiring words. I’m quite happy that my day lends itself to conversation about God’s Word rather than the need for a word that usually signifies opposition or contradiction or maybe making a difficult choice.

Which brings me to last month’s typo …. My previous column in The Write Conversation compared and contrasted writing retreats and writing conferences. Whereas both have been beneficial to my writing, finances and time constraints often cause me to choose one over the other, a difficult choice usually.
